Eli specifications for C, FORTRAN, and other languages can be accessed
via the URL http://www.cs.colorado.edu/~eliuser/EliExamples.html. All
of the specifications now include lexical, syntactic and semantic
analysis of their respective languages, and all are compatible with
Eli-4.0.


These specifications can be used as the basis for language extensions,
feature and property analyzers, quality assurance processors, and
compilers. They are free of any licensing or copyright restrictions.
